Transaction 39a6629a72a933d48790eda1d6bee983e04caf29e1452244b400e1e4a3be2d60

2 Input
2 Outputs
  • 39a6629a72a933d48790eda1d6bee983e04caf29e1452244b400e1e4a3be2d60:0
  • value  2511840
    address  39We51DaxxiFXRJve7AiFNeyM895YUkYoz
  • 39a6629a72a933d48790eda1d6bee983e04caf29e1452244b400e1e4a3be2d60:1
  • value  968415234
    address  3DXP2PMnVfj1DqTVTrYmvrUobEptLGTm9A